[soft music concludes] [dramatic music playing] Presenter: One of the greatest
peacetime spy dramas in the nation's history
reaches its climax as Julius Rosenberg
and Mrs. Ethel Rosenberg, who, with her husband,
was convicted of actually transmitting
the secrets to Russia through Soviet diplomatic channels, enter the Federal Building
in New York to hear their doom. It is a stern jurist they face
in Judge Irving Kaufman. He sentenced both Rosenbergs
to death in the electric chair. It is the first time
in peacetime that such a death penalty
has been handed down, and while appeals to the
highest courts are planned, it certainly appears
that the spies are headed along
a one-way street. When the verdict came down,
